PDF ドキュメント内のハイパーリンクは、参照を提供したり、外部リソースに接続したりするためによく使用されます。C# を使用して PDF からハイパーリンクを抽出する は、ドキュメントの処理、分析、管理に関係するアプリケーションにとって貴重な機能です。C# で PDF からハイパーリンクを読み取る 方法を学習することで、PDF 内に埋め込まれた URL に効率的にアクセスして操作できます。この機能は、コンテンツ分析ツール、ドキュメント管理システム、または既存のワークフローの強化に特に役立ちます。単一の PDF ファイルで作業する場合でも、大規模なバッチを処理する場合でも、この方法によりハイパーリンクが正確かつ効率的に抽出され、ドキュメント管理プロセスが最適化されます。
C# を使用して PDF からハイパーリンクを抽出する手順
- NuGet を介して C# プロジェクトに GroupDocs.Parser for .NET ライブラリを追加し、PDF ファイルからのハイパーリンク抽出を有効にします。
- Parser オブジェクトを初期化して、その機能と性能を活用します
- Parser.GetHyperlinksメソッドを呼び出して、ドキュメント内に存在するすべてのハイパーリンクを抽出します。
- PageHyperlinkArea コレクションをループして、各ハイパーリンクを個別に処理します。
これらの手順に従うことで、C# で PDF ドキュメントからハイパーリンクを効率的に抽出できます。この機能は、ハイパーリンクの整合性を維持することが重要なコンテンツ監査、データ抽出、ドキュメント変換などのシナリオで特に役立ちます。たとえば、コンテンツ監査では大量のドキュメント内のリンクの確認と検証が行われ、データ抽出では分析やレポート用の URL の収集に重点が置かれ、ドキュメント変換では PDF を他の形式に変換するときにハイパーリンクが維持されます。この方法はプラットフォームに依存しないため、Windows、Linux、macOS 環境でシームレスに動作し、さまざまなアプリケーションに使用できる多目的ソリューションになります。以下は、PDF ハイパーリンクを抽出する C# コード です。
C# を使用して PDF からハイパーリンクを抽出するコード
結論として、共有プロセスは、コンテンツ監査、データ抽出、ドキュメント変換などのさまざまなアプリケーションにとって貴重なツールです。この方法を使用すると、C# を使用して PDF からハイパーリンクを取得できます。コンテンツ管理システム、ドキュメント分析ツール、または変換ユーティリティのいずれで作業している場合でも、ハイパーリンク抽出をアプリケーションに統合すると、パフォーマンスが向上し、より効率的なドキュメント管理エクスペリエンスが提供されます。PDF リンクを抽出して管理することで、アプリケーションのドキュメント処理能力が向上し、ワークフローの効率とデータの精度が向上します。
以前、C# を使用して DOCX からハイパーリンクを抽出する方法に関する包括的なガイドを公開しました。より詳細な手順については、C# を使用して DOCX からハイパーリンクを抽出する の方法に関するステップバイステップのチュートリアルを必ずご覧ください。